## Migrating cron jobs to Larkspur

Each legacy cron entry on the scheduler box becomes a Larkspur workflow definition. Port the schedule expression verbatim, then wrap the shell command in a task step with retries set to 3. Reviewers: confirm idempotency notes are present before approving. The workflow engine persists run history in the Fennelwick metadata database, which it reaches via the connection string below.

replica DSN, kajep-yahag: mssql://praok_svc:iF@db-8d68.plorvaio.local:5432/eliion

## Tideline Widget — Embed Steps

Fetch tide predictions from the Marrow Bay endpoint before render. Cache responses for 30 minutes; the upstream rate limit is strict. Handle null high-tide entries gracefully — some stations report partial days. All plugin requests must authenticate against the internal prediction service using the key below.

API key for yahig-tadup: kto7_ubizbYm

Re: Retirement of the Stonebriar product line

Stonebriar sales have declined for five consecutive quarters and support costs now exceed contribution margin. The retirement plan is staged: new orders close end of Q2, existing contracts honoured through their terms, and spares stocked for twenty-four months. Sales leads should steer prospects toward the Ashgrove range; migration incentives are already approved. Customer comms are drafted and awaiting legal sign-off. The forward strategy behind this decision is set out in the note below.

confidential, yafog-hagug: Gross margin on Druix came in at 10 percent against a plan of 15 percent. Only 5 of the 80 pilot accounts renewed Druix, so a churn review is set for October 1.

## Changelog — Stocktally reconciliation job

Changed defaults for the nightly inventory reconciliation run. Batch size reduced; previous value caused lock contention on the Fernwick warehouse tables. Mismatch tolerance tightened from percentage-based to absolute counts. Dry-run mode now defaults to off — reviewers, note this is a behavior change, not just tuning. Retry backoff switched to exponential. Orphaned SKU handling now quarantines rather than deletes. No schema changes. The new default configuration as shipped is reproduced below.

config for haweg-bagag:
[kasath]
host = kasath.qirvancorp.internal
user = kasath_svc
database = kasath_prod